L-Arginine is an essential amino acid in stressful situations and a precursor to the formation of nitric oxide: it helps trigger the relaxation of blood vessels and intervenes in nitrogen transport, storage, and excretion processes1.
There are several scientific studies that explain the benefits of L-Arginine supplementation. Among them, it stands out that its intake helps improve wound healing by promoting cell replication and immune response1 and that, associated with a weight training program, its oral administration enhances the stimuli of exercise at the level of skeletal muscles, providing greater strength and muscle mass2.

Others argue that this substance stimulates the secretion of growth hormone from the pituitary gland; that it is one of the precursors of creatine; and that it is essential for the production of urea (necessary for the removal of toxic ammonia from the body)3.
